I am considering a trade for my 6/4 ZO I bought from Tom McGrady a little over a year ago. I have a pt6p issued to me for my gigs in the Navy and think it would be best to have my personal horn be something that is similar to what I use at work every day.

The ZO is an amazing horn and is as good as any 6/4 horn I've played. I "had" to buy it after I played it the first time. This is from the first batch of two Tom was selling last year. It doesn't have the engraving that the new ones have but it is still a very nice looking instrument. It has some small dings and scratches but nothing major.

I would like to see if I could find a trade partner willing to trade a used PT6 or Wiseman 900.
